  • What happens in the Advanced Decay stage?

    Most soft tissues are gone, leaving bones and connective tissue. Soil around the body may show staining from fluids, and insect activity decreases significantly.

  • What certifications are recognized in the crime scene cleanup industry?

    Recognized certifications include IICRC, EPA training, OSHA compliance, and various state-specific licenses for hazardous remediation.

  • What specialized tools assist in crime scene cleanup?

    Specialized tools include HEPA vacuums, bio-scanners, containment barriers, and industrial-grade cleaning agents designed for hazardous environments.

  • What training is needed for biohazard cleaning professionals?

    Training includes bloodborne pathogen courses, hazardous material handling, and safety protocols.

  • How is chemical residue detected?

    Specialized sensors and testing kits are used to identify and verify the complete removal of chemical residues.

  • Is crime scene cleanup expensive and covered by insurance?

    While costs vary based on the extent of contamination, many insurance policies cover biohazard remediation when proper documentation is provided.

  • What measures are taken to ensure worker safety?

    Workers follow strict safety protocols, use full PPE, and operate in controlled environments to minimize exposure to biohazards.

  • What occurs during the Bloat stage?

    Bacteria produce gases like methane and carbon dioxide, causing the body to bloat. Fluids are expelled, and the skin may discolor and loosen. This stage is marked by a strong odor.

  • What should I do if I find rodent droppings in my home?

    Avoid sweeping or vacuuming dry droppings. Contact a professional cleanup service for proper removal and sanitation.
